HEART DISEASES :

The more you are obese the load on the heart is more. The possibility of heart disease in obese in men is about 42 percent and 75 percent in women according to experts. Death due to heart disease is more among obese. Especially android type of obesity is a major risk factor for heart damage and heart disease as there is high cholesterol. Android is the male type of obesity where excess fat is marked in the upper half of the body. In these persons the vital organs affected will be mostly the heart, liver, kidneys and lungs.
The android type persons shall avoid or even reduce the intake of food which is high in the cholesterol and do the exercise regularly.

When the fat tissues surround the liver gall bladder, heart, intestines and kidneys and go on accumulating further the weight increases pushing and the whole abdomen. There are many vital reasons for heart diseases. All heart diseases are not destructive. Most of the heart diseases are curable. Let there be any reason for heart diseases, patients has to take care of this body weight. The weight should be according to age the age and height. It is good to reduce fat in the daily intake of food. The food requirement varies from person to person. Low salt foods are acceptable. Heart patients and persons suffering from high blood pressure do not tolerate salt. Better if it is eliminated. Exercises help. They ease blood circulation, reform digestion and enable elimination of impurities. The exercises are not same for aged, weak and youth. They differ. Better to consult a physician and decide the nature of exercise.
